¿Qué es compilar un programa?

Preguntado por: Rosa María Burgos Segundo  |  Última actualización: 6 de enero de 2022
Puntuación: 4.5/5 (14 valoraciones)

En informática, un compilador es un programa que traduce código escrito en un lenguaje de programación a otro lenguaje.​ En este tipo de traductor, el lenguaje fuente es generalmente un lenguaje de alto nivel, y el objeto un lenguaje de bajo nivel.​

¿Cómo se puede compilar un programa?

Compilar es traducir el programa de un lenguaje entendible por los humanos a un lenguaje entendible por la máquina, el código máquina o binario. Tenemos varias maneras de hacer lo mismo. La más rápida es utilizar las teclas Ctrl-F9 pero no siempre lo recordaremos.

¿Qué sucede cuando se compila un programa?

Compilar es el proceso de transformar un programa informático escrito en un lenguaje en un programa equivalente en otro formato. Normalmente, un compilador transforma un lenguaje de alto nivel como C o Java, el cual es legible por los humanos, en un lenguaje máquina que la CPU puede entender. ...

¿Qué es compilar el código?

La palabra compilar significa traducir un código de programación a codigo ejecutable por la máquina. ... Se utiliza mucho en programación de lenguaje C. Es el proceso mediante el cual se traduce un código de programación a un código que puede procesar la maquina, Es decir un código fuente a un ejecutable.

¿Qué es una compilación y para qué sirve?

En Informática, como compilación se denomina la fase de codificación en que un programa es traducido del código fuente al código máquina para que pueda ejecutarse. Como tal, la realiza un compilador virtual, cuya tarea consiste en llevar un programa fuente a programa objeto.

¿Qué es COMPILAR? - Diccionario de la PROGRAMACIÓN #010

37 preguntas relacionadas encontradas

¿Cuando hablamos de las compilaciones protegidas Nos referimos a?

del ADPIC señala que las compilaciones de datos o de otros materiales, en forma legible por máquina o en otra forma, que por razones de selección y disposición de sus contenidos constituyan creaciones de carácter intelectual, serán protegidas como tales.

¿Qué es un compilador en la literatura?

'Compilador' es el término legal, es decir el que se usa en la Ley federal del derecho de autor y que corresponde a la persona que se ocupa de los libros multiautorales, de las memorias de coloquios o de las antologías (traducidas o no).

¿Cómo compilar un código en C?

Cómo programar en C desde Linux
  1. Crea un archivo en texto plano pero guárdalo con la extensión «. c«.
  2. Ahora, en la terminal, ejecuta: gcc programa. c -o programa (compila el archivo programa.c y le llamamos «programa») ./programa (ejecuta el programa).

¿Cómo funciona un compilador de código?

Para resumir, un compilador funciona de la siguiente forma: El código fuente se lee en la memoria de la computadora. El código fuente se convierte en código objeto o módulo de objeto. ... Se reasignan los bloques de memoria dentro del programa de modo que una pieza no sobreponga a otra parte en la memoria.

¿Qué es código en C++?

C++ es un lenguaje de programación diseñado en 1979 por Bjarne Stroustrup. La intención de su creación fue extender al lenguaje de programación C mecanismos que permiten la manipulación de objetos. En ese sentido, desde el punto de vista de los lenguajes orientados a objetos, C++ es un lenguaje híbrido.

¿Cuál es la diferencia entre compilar y ejecutar un programa?

Un programa compilado es más rápido de ejecutar que uno interpretado pero se tarda más a compilar y ejecutar un programa que a interpretarlo. Es cierto que un compilador generar programas más rápidos. La clave es que cada sentencia se analiza una sola vez y no una vez en cada ejecución.

¿Qué es un intérprete en la programación?

En ciencias de la computación, intérprete o interpretador es un programa informático capaz de analizar y ejecutar otros programas. ... Usando un intérprete, un solo archivo fuente puede producir resultados iguales incluso en sistemas sumamente diferentes (ejemplo. una PC y una PlayStation 4).

¿Qué es un programa ejecutable cómo pueden ser?

Un ejecutable es un archivo diseñado para poder iniciar un programa. En su interior están pues las instrucciones precisas para poder ejecutar un programa determinado o varios. Los ordenadores pueden realizar todo tipo de tareas, pero para ello debe indicárseles como.

¿Cómo ejecutar un programa en C?

Ahora, debería poder ejecutar el código C mediante una de las siguientes formas:
  1. Usando el atajo Ctrl + Alt + N.
  2. Presione F1 y luego seleccione o escriba Código de ejecución.
  3. Haga clic derecho en el editor de texto y luego haga clic en Ejecutar código desde el menú contextual.

¿Cómo ejecutar un programa de Fortran?

Para ejecutar el programa, se deberá teclear el nombre del archivo ejecutable, por ejemplo a. out. (Esta parte esta un poco simplificada, ya que realmente el compilador traduce el código fuente en código objeto y entonces usando el ligador/cargador se genera un archivo ejecutable.)

¿Cómo funciona un traductor de lenguaje compilador?

Un compilador generalmente genera lenguaje ensamblador primero y luego traduce el lenguaje ensamblador al lenguaje máquina. Una utilidad conocida como «enlazador» combina todos los módulos de lenguaje de máquina necesarios en un programa ejecutable que se puede ejecutar en la computadora.

¿Cuál es la función de un compilador?

Un compilador es un programa informático que traduce un programa escrito en un lenguaje de programación, definido «código fuente», a otro lenguaje de alto (COBOL, PASCAL, BASIC, C, etc.), medio o más bajo nivel (código intermedio o código máquina) como puede ser C/C++.

¿Qué es un compilador en lenguajes y automatas?

Un compilador es un programa que traduce un programa escrito en un lenguaje a (lenguaje fuente) a un lenguaje b (lenguaje objeto). Un alfabeto es un conjunto finito y no vacío de elementos llamados símbolos o letras.

¿Cómo ejecutar código en C++?

Escriba cmd.exe en el cuadro de texto Abrir y luego elija Aceptar para ejecutar una ventana del símbolo del sistema. En la ventana del símbolo del sistema, haga clic con el botón derecho para pegar la ruta de acceso a la aplicación en el símbolo del sistema. Presione Entrar para ejecutar el código.

¿Cómo se compila un programa en Dev C++?

Simplemente ve al menú Ejecutar y haz clic en Compilar (o presionando : Ctrl+F9), y Dev-C++ será el que se preocupe de llamar al compilador y al linker.

¿Cuál es el significado de compilador?

Compilador es aquel o aquello que compila: es decir, que reúne diversos elementos o fragmentos en una misma unidad. ... En el terreno de la informática, compilar consiste en traducir un programa escrito en un cierto lenguaje a otro.

¿Qué es un editor y qué es un compilador?

El proceso habitual para crear una aplicación informática es editar el código fuente (escribir el programa en el lenguaje de programación elegido), compilarlo (es decir, traducirlo al lenguaje máquina) y ejecutar la aplicación.

¿Qué es un compilador y ejemplos?

Un compilador es un programa que traduce un programa escrito en lenguaje fuente y produce otro equivalente escrito en un lenguaje destino. Lenguaje de alto nivel. Por ejemplo: C, Pascal, C++.

Articolo precedente
¿Dónde se fabrican las zapatillas yuccs?
Articolo successivo
¿Cuántos metros tiene que tener un camino de servidumbre?